overestimate

menaksir terlalu tinggi
definition
verb
his influence cannot be overestimated
estimate (something) to be better, larger, or more important than it really is.
noun
Such effects would include: overestimates or underestimates of results during the observation and recording phase of an experiment, errors in interpreting the data, and the fabrication of data.
an excessively high estimate.
